引言
随着人工智能技术的不断发展,大模型在处理复杂任务方面展现出巨大潜力。然而,多模态任务的处理对大模型提出了更高的要求。本文将探讨大模型在处理多模态任务时面临的挑战,以及如何有效驾驭这些挑战。
多模态任务概述
多模态任务是指同时处理两种或两种以上不同类型的数据,如文本、图像、音频和视频等。这类任务在自然语言处理、计算机视觉、语音识别等领域有着广泛的应用。
大模型在多模态任务中的挑战
1. 模态融合
多模态任务的核心挑战在于如何有效地融合不同模态的信息。不同模态的数据在表示、结构和语义上存在差异,如何将这些信息整合到一个统一的框架中是一个关键问题。
2. 数据同步
在多模态任务中,不同模态的数据通常具有不同的采样率和时间戳。如何同步这些数据,以便模型能够正确理解和处理它们,是一个技术难题。
3. 计算效率
多模态任务通常需要处理大量数据,这给模型的计算效率带来了巨大挑战。如何在不牺牲性能的前提下,提高模型的计算效率,是一个重要的研究方向。
4. 语义理解
多模态任务中的语义理解是一个复杂的问题。不同模态的数据可能具有不同的语义信息,如何准确地理解和提取这些信息,是模型能否成功的关键。
驾驭多模态任务挑战的方法
1. 模态融合技术
为了解决模态融合问题,研究人员提出了多种技术,如:
- 特征融合:将不同模态的特征映射到一个共同的语义空间,以便进行融合。
- 深度学习:利用深度学习模型,如卷积神经网络(CNN)和循环神经网络(RNN),来学习不同模态之间的关联。
2. 数据同步策略
针对数据同步问题,可以采用以下策略:
- 时间对齐:通过时间戳对齐不同模态的数据,以便进行同步处理。
- 插值和补全:对于缺失或部分缺失的数据,采用插值或补全方法来填充。
3. 计算效率优化
为了提高计算效率,可以采取以下措施:
- 模型压缩:通过模型压缩技术,如剪枝、量化等,来减小模型大小和计算复杂度。
- 分布式训练:利用分布式计算资源,加速模型的训练和推理过程。
4. 语义理解提升
为了提升语义理解能力,可以采用以下方法:
- 多模态上下文学习:通过学习多模态上下文,提高模型对不同模态信息的理解能力。
- 知识增强:利用外部知识库,增强模型对复杂语义的理解。
总结
大模型在处理多模态任务时面临着诸多挑战。通过采用有效的模态融合技术、数据同步策略、计算效率优化和语义理解提升方法,可以有效地驾驭这些挑战。随着技术的不断发展,大模型在多模态任务中的应用前景将更加广阔。